在XP系统下创建VPN主机,首先需安装VPN服务器软件,如Windows Server 2003的RRAS。接着配置IP地址、DNS和WINS,设置远程访问策略,启用网络策略服务器,最后创建VPN连接并配置用户权限。确保所有设置无误后,即可完成VPN主机的创建。
VPN(虚拟私人网络)技术,作为一种通过网络环境实现远程计算机与本地网络安全连接的技术,被广泛运用于企业内部网络和远程办公等场景,尽管Windows XP已是一款较为古老的操作系统,但仍有大量用户在使用,本文将详细介绍如何在Windows XP系统上搭建VPN主机。
准备工作
1. 确认您的Windows XP系统已安装了IIS(Internet Information Services)服务,IIS是Windows系统中的Web服务器组件,支持提供Web服务和FTP服务等功能。
2. 获取VPN客户端软件,例如OpenVPN或PPTP等,本文将以OpenVPN为例进行讲解。
3. 确保您的网络连接稳定,并且带宽充足,以保证vpn.com/tags-37438.html" class="superseo">VPN服务的顺畅运行。
创建VPN主机
1. 打开“控制面板”,点击“添加或删除程序”。
2. 在弹出的窗口中,点击“添加/删除Windows组件”。
3. 在“Windows组件向导”中,勾选“IIS(Internet Information Services)”选项,然后点击“下一步”。
4. 按照提示完成IIS的安装过程。
5. 再次打开“控制面板”,点击“性能和维护”,然后点击“管理工具”。
6. 在“管理工具”窗口中,双击“Internet信息服务(IIS)管理器”。
7. 在“Internet信息服务(IIS)管理器”窗口中,展开左侧的“本地计算机”,找到并点击“目录”。
8. 右键点击“目录”,选择“添加虚拟目录”。
9. 在“添加虚拟目录向导”中,输入虚拟目录的名称,VPN”,然后点击“下一步”。
10. 在“浏览”窗口中,选择一个用于存放VPN配置文件的目录,例如C:VPN,然后点击“下一步”。
11. 在“访问权限”选项卡中,勾选“读取”、“写入”和“执行”复选框,然后点击“下一步”。
12. 完成虚拟目录的添加后,返回“Internet信息服务(IIS)管理器”窗口。
13. 展开目录,找到刚才添加的“VPN”虚拟目录。
14. 在右侧操作栏中,点击“绑定”,在弹出的窗口中,选择“HTTP”协议,然后点击“添加”。
15. 在“添加HTTP地址”窗口中,输入VPN服务器的IP地址和端口号(默认为443),然后点击“确定”。
16. 点击“确定”返回“Internet信息服务(IIS)管理器”窗口。
配置VPN服务器
1. 在“VPN”虚拟目录下,找到“OpenVPN”文件夹。
2. 双击打开“OpenVPN”文件夹中的“config”文件夹。
3. 在“config”文件夹中,找到并右键点击“server.ovpn”文件,选择以“记事本”方式打开。
4. 修改“server.ovpn”文件的内容以配置VPN服务器,以下为部分示例配置:
remoteca ca.crt
cert server.crt
key server.key
cipher BF-CBC
需要根据实际情况修改《VPN客户端IP地址》和《VPN客户端端口》。
5. 保存并关闭“server.ovpn”文件。
6. 返回“OpenVPN”文件夹,找到“scripts”文件夹。
7. 在“scripts”文件夹中,找到并右键点击“start-all.bat”文件,选择“以管理员身份运行”。
8. 运行完毕后,VPN服务器启动成功。
通过上述步骤,您已在Windows XP系统上成功创建了一台VPN主机,用户可以通过获取的VPN客户端软件连接到VPN服务器,实现远程访问企业内部网络等功能,在实际应用中,还需对VPN服务器进行安全加固,例如设置密码、限制访问权限等措施。